Dec 24 - Asian shares edged lower Wednesday in holiday-thinned trading, with regional car and parts makers hit on plummeting demand.
Toyota fell after forecasting its first ever loss of $1.7 billion, while tyre-maker Bridgestone slumped after cutting its operating profit forecast for the year to $1.3 billion.
